The Netflix original series, Love Alarm, has released the first look stills of the romance between the main leads along with the announcement of the series being released on March 12.

Based on the popular webtoon of the same name, Love Alarm is set in a world where a mobile app alerts you if someone within a 10-meter radius likes you. Starring the likes of Kim So-hyun, Jung Ga-ram, and Song Kang, there’s no better time than now to watch (or re-watch) the first season as you wait for season two.

The new stills show Kim Jo-ju meeting Lee Hye-yeong and Hwang Sun-oh individually. While they have graduated from high school and have become adults, they still have unresolved worries and conflicts.

Netflix has confirmed that the second season takes place four years after the creation of the app which has recently released Love Alarm 2.0. The update comes with a new feature that shows users a list of people who are likely to like them in the future. Kim Jo-jo, who still hides her feelings, will come across a variety of small and large changes in society influenced by the app. 

Love Alarm S2 is directed by Kim Jin-woo of Good Doctor, Queen of Mystery, and Suits and Ryu Bora, who is the writer of Snowy Road and Secret, participated as script producer.
